According to Beethoven’s pupil Ferdinand Ries, the Horn Sonata op. 17 was written in great haste in April 1800 for a subscription concert organized by the natural-horn player Johann Wenzel and held at Vienna’s Hofburgtheater. The present edition of the often played work derives from a single surviving source, the first edition of 1801; it also adopts its notation, particularly in the domain of articulation (staccato dots, dashesand wedges). Suggested fingerings have been added to the piano part. Further editorial additions are clearly marked.
